Short Shakespeare! A Midsummer Night's Dream

Chicago Shakespeare Theater
800 East Grand Avenue Chicago

A magical forest, impish fairies and a host of some of Shakespeare’s most comedic characters make A Midsummer Night’s Dream one of his most popular plays—and a perfect introduction to theater. When lovers cross with mischievous sprites in an enchanted forest, a series of mishaps occur and nothing is what it seems. Add to the mix a bevy of fumbling actors and all chaos breaks loose until dawn breaks and all is once again right with the world.

ChicagoCritic - Highly Recommended

"...The bottom line on this one is that if you have the opportunity to introduce a young person to Shakespeare, this is the show you want. And if you can’t round up a kid to take with you, it is good Shakespeare in its own right. CST’s A Midsummer Night’s Dream is living proof of the bard’s universality and power to inspire theatrical artists across time. It is funny and entertaining and just about as good as a youth theatre production could be."

Randy Hardwick
